Police Investigate Overnight Tire, Wheel Theft

The suspects' vehicle has been recovered, but police are still searching for men involved in the incident.

 

The  is searching for two suspects who allegedly stole about $11,000 worth of tires and wheels from a home early Thursday morning.

Police received an emergency call that two men were removing tires and wheels from a car on Colonial Drive just after 3:30 a.m. The caller told police that the suspects had taken the tires and wheels off the car and placed it in another vehicle before fleeing the scene.

The suspects' car was located in the area of 1800 Silas Deane Hwy. Police conducted an extensive search of the area, however the suspects were not located. Hartford and Wethersfield Police as well as members of the Connecticut State Police Department assisted in the search.

The police department seized the suspects’ vehicle. According to police, the four tires and wheels were estimated at $11,000 and have been recovered.

The investigation is ongoing at this time. Police do not believe the suspects in the incident "pose a danger to the community."
